Tattoos are represented in early chinese texts, including histories, dynastic penal codes, zhiguai xiaoshuo and biji works, and early prose works such as the shangshu. Tattooing in china is called ci shen (or wen shen), a term that means literally “puncture the body.” although the art has been known in china for ages, it has for the most part been an uncommon practice. Web in ancient china, tattoo art was called 涅 (niè) which means “to dye black”.
